Don Allen Baker, age 83, of Hickory, NC, passed away on January 27, 2026. A man of defined melody, rhythm, and a deep devotion to his loved ones, Don leaves behind a legacy of music that resonated across the Carolinas and beyond.

A graveside service will be held on Saturday, May 23, 2026, 11:00 AM, at Westview Cemetery in Kinston, NC.

Born in Kinston, NC, to the late Douglas Lonnie Baker and Ruby Barnes Baker, Don grew up with a horn in his hand and a song in his heart. A late 1960 graduate of Grainger High School, he went on to study at East Carolina University before embarking on a distinguished career as a professional musician.

An accomplished keyboardist and trumpeter, Don was a cornerstone of the beach music scene. He toured professionally with The Monzas, preforming on their hit "Instant Love" and showcasing his songwriting talents on the B-side, "Social Unrest." His musical journey continued well into the new millennium as he performed with The Sensational Epics out of Alanta. His contributions to the genre were formally recognized with his induction into the Carolina Beach Music Hall of Fame.

Don was blessed with two great loves in his life. He was married for 51 years to his beloved wife, Cheryl Bruffey Baker, with whom he built a beautiful life and family. Following Cheryl's passing, Don found a "second angel" in Debra Caywood, whom he met in 2015. His children remained eternally grateful to Debra for restoring his spirit and bringing love and life back into his world during his final decade.

When he wasn't on stage or behind a keyboard, Don could be found cheering on his favorite team as a lifelong, die-hard Tarheels fan. He retired from Airserv in 2005, allowing him more time to focus on his family and his passions.
